観察結果の詳細
Unusually dark and long-billed pewee, but not Dark Pewee, as that species tends to be more slaty-gray than dark brown, and tends to have a bigger crest (more Greater Pewee-like, which this bird wasn't). Overall plumage quite worn, possibly from a long journey. This could be an unusually dark and drab Western or even Eastern Wood-Pewee, as good numbers of them seemed to be around, but the bird didn't strike me as a good match for either. Not sure if a South American migratory Contopus should be considered (or if such a thing exists). Bird sallied from exposed perch to flycatch and came back to the perch, as Contopus typically do. The bird never vocalized. The crest seems to show a paler central area.
